This commit renames `AllocationType` to `AllocationOption` across multiple files, enhancing clarity in memory allocation practices. Key updates include: - Modifications to the `UnsafeArray`, `ParallelNoiseBenchmark`, `Arena`, and `DynamicArena` classes to utilize the new `AllocationOption`. - Refactoring of the `AllocationManager` and `HashMapHelper` classes to support the new allocation strategy. - Removal of the `Misaki.HighPerformance.Mathematics` project reference, indicating a restructuring of dependencies. - Introduction of a new `MathUtilities` class for calculating the smallest power of two, aiding memory allocation strategies. These changes collectively improve code maintainability and clarity in memory management.
